Summer Stock Stage will present the Central Indiana premiere of DEAR EVAN HANSEN from August 5-9, 2026, at the Schrott Center for the Arts, Butler University. The production will star newcomer Preston Angus as Evan Hansen and introduce Erin Rosenfeld, the first Deaf actor to play Zoe Murphy, alongside Isabella Agresta.
